Nuggets regain control of playoff destiny; Clippers eliminated

-

LOS ANGELES — Will Barton scored 31 points as the Denver Nuggets kept their playoffs hopes alive with a 134-115 victory over the Los Angeles Clippers on Saturday.

Nikola Jokic finished with 23 points, 11 rebounds and 11 assists as the Nuggets won their fifth straight to move into a tie with the Minnesota Timberwolv­es for eighth place in the Western Conference with two games to play. Both teams are 45-35.

With the offense leading the way some nights and the defense on others, the Nuggets have regained control of their playoff destiny.

They will reach the post-season if they win their last two NBA games. The Nuggets finish the regular season at home against Portland on Monday night.

On Saturday, Denver started quickly on the attack, making 10 of their first 12 shots.

The stage is now set for the Nuggets’ season-ending game against the Timberwolv­es in Minneapoli­s on Wednesday. Minnesota, which holds the tiebreaker over the Nuggets, hosts Memphis on Monday.

The loss eliminated the struggling Clippers from the postseason race as they lost for the fourth time in the past five games. The loss ends a string of six straight post-season appearance­s for the Clippers.

WIN STREAK SNAPPED

Elsewhere, Russell Westbrook and Paul George combined for 48 points as the Oklahoma City Thunder pulled away in the fourth quarter to beat the Houston Rockets, 108-102.

Oklahoma City was behind by one point with seven minutes to go before going on an 11-0 burst.

The host Rockets scored five straight points with less than a minute left to get within five, but George made two free throws to clinch the win and snap Houston’s 20-game home win streak.

The Thunder are battling with a number of teams for the final playoff berths in the Western Conference.

Carmelo Anthony tallied 22 points for the Thunder, including some clutch three pointers.

James Harden had 26 and Chris Paul chipped in 17 points for the Rockets in the loss. —
